It's 2018 and I still feel a huge distance between us and Akai Pro. So many bugs where submitted during the Beta period and maybe 30% have been resolved. Exporting drumtracks to audio tracks will result in a 16 bit file even tough your project settings are at 24 bit. A lot of vst plugin names are presented wrong on the touch srceen interface and sometimes it just shows 'empty' even tough there is a vst plugin loaded. The GUI wont remember it's position when you switch between modes. So when your viewing the mixer and are making some adjustments to the sub busses and switch to the sampler and after the sampler back to the mixer you'll have to scroll all the way back to the sub busses. The same thing in track mode when your viewing track 26 and leave and come back to track mode you'll have to scroll all the way back down to track 26.
